Pyeong-hwa
/PYEONGHWA/
Pure Korean Sino-Korean compound 평화 — pyeong 平 ('flat/peaceful') + hwa 和 ('harmony/peace'), meaning 'peace' — used by Korean Catholic families to invoke the Korean Catholic newspaper 평화신문 (Pyeonghwa Sinmun) and Pope Paul VI's encyclical Pacem in Terris.
